  • civil12345 wrote: »
    Does anyone know the answer to the questions I've posted?

    No because there are so many variables - nobody can foresee the future.
    Over the last decade we have have had relatively low inflation - who knows what it will be in the future - how long will your relative live?
    If you pay for a funeral now what happens if the undertakers go bust?
    The only good thing about an over 50's plan IMO is that they do not ask any medical questions and they will take anybody on - that's it really - £25 invested in stock and shares over say 10 years should be a better investment.
